Setup
1. Charging the iPod Classic
Before first use, fully charge your iPod Classic. Connect the included USB cable to the iPod's dock connector port and the other end to a USB power adapter (not included) or a computer's USB port. The battery icon on the screen will indicate charging status.
2. Installing iTunes
To manage your music, videos, and photos, you need to install Apple iTunes on your computer. Download the latest version from the official Apple website (www.apple.com/itunes).
3. Connecting to Computer
Connect your iPod Classic to your computer using the USB cable. iTunes will automatically launch and detect your device. Follow the on-screen prompts in iTunes to set up your iPod, including naming it and configuring synchronization options.
Operating Instructions
Navigating the iPod Classic
The iPod Classic is primarily controlled using the Click Wheel. The Click Wheel consists of a touch-sensitive surface and four physical buttons, plus a central button.
- MENU: Press to go back to the previous menu or to the main menu.
- Center Button: Press to select an item or play/pause.
- Play/Pause (bottom): Press to play or pause playback.
- Previous/Rewind (left): Press to go to the previous track or hold to rewind.
- Next/Fast Forward (right): Press to go to the next track or hold to fast forward.
- Touch Surface: Slide your finger clockwise or counter-clockwise around the wheel to scroll through menus and adjust volume.
Playing Music
- From the main menu, select Music.
- Navigate through categories such as Artists, Albums, Songs, Genres, etc., using the Click Wheel.
- Press the Center Button to select a song or album to begin playback.
Viewing Videos and Photos
- To view videos, select Videos from the main menu and choose your desired content.
- To view photos, select Photos from the main menu and browse your photo albums.
Maintenance
Cleaning Your iPod Classic
Use a soft, lint-free cloth to clean the screen and casing of your iPod. Avoid using abrasive materials, alcohol, or chemical cleaners, as these can damage the device.
Battery Care
To prolong battery life, avoid exposing your iPod to extreme temperatures. For long-term storage, charge the battery to about 50% and store it in a cool, dry place.
Software Updates
Regularly connect your iPod to iTunes to check for and install the latest software updates. This ensures optimal performance and access to new features.

Specifications
- Model: MC293LL/A
- Storage Capacity: 160 GB
- Screen Size: 2.5 Inches
- Connectivity: USB, Aux
- Supported Audio Formats: MP3, AAC, AIFF, WAV
- Battery Life: Up to 36 hours audio playback, 6 hours video playback
- Dimensions (H x W x D): 4.1 x 2.4 x 0.4 inches (103.5 x 61.8 x 10.5 mm)
- Weight: 4.9 ounces (140 grams)
- Manufacturer: Apple
